The Evolution of AI
AI has evolved significantly since its inception. Early forms of AI were rule-based systems designed to follow a specific set of instructions. However, the true power of AI began to emerge with the advent of machine learning and deep learning, subsets of AI that allow systems to learn from data and improve over time without being explicitly programmed. These advances have enabled AI to tackle tasks once thought impossible for machines, from natural language processing to image recognition and autonomous systems.
Key innovations like neural networks, reinforcement learning, and generative models have only accelerated AI's evolution, making it a driving force behind technologies such as natural language models (like GPT), virtual assistants, and autonomous vehicles.
How AI is Transforming Industries
AI is revolutionizing almost every sector, from healthcare and finance to manufacturing and entertainment. Its applications are vast and growing, driving efficiency, improving decision-making, and unlocking new capabilities across industries.
1. Healthcare
In healthcare, AI is playing a critical role in diagnosis, drug development, and personalized medicine. Algorithms can now analyze medical images, predict patient outcomes, and even suggest treatment plans based on historical data. Machine learning models have been used to predict the spread of diseases, monitor patients' vital signs in real-time, and expedite clinical trials by identifying suitable candidates more quickly. AI-driven technologies are also enhancing surgical precision, reducing errors, and improving patient outcomes.
2. Finance
In the financial sector, AI is transforming how companies handle fraud detection, credit risk analysis, and customer service. Algorithms can analyze vast amounts of data to identify unusual transactions, flagging potential fraud faster than human analysts could. Robo-advisors use AI to provide personalized investment advice and portfolio management, while predictive models help banks assess creditworthiness more accurately. Moreover, AI-driven chatbots enhance customer experience by providing real-time assistance, reducing the need for human intervention.
3. Manufacturing
In manufacturing, AI-powered robotics and automation have greatly enhanced production efficiency. AI is optimizing supply chain management, reducing downtime by predicting machinery failures, and ensuring high-quality production through smart quality control systems. Predictive maintenance, powered by AI, helps companies avoid costly breakdowns by monitoring equipment health and forecasting issues before they happen. This not only cuts costs but also minimizes waste and energy consumption, contributing to sustainability goals.
4. Retail and E-commerce
Retailers are increasingly using AI to personalize shopping experiences and streamline operations. AI algorithms analyze consumer behavior and preferences, offering personalized recommendations that improve customer engagement. Chatbots provide instant customer service, while predictive analytics optimize inventory management by forecasting demand trends. AI is also reshaping the supply chain, with intelligent automation reducing delivery times and improving logistics.
5. Entertainment and Media
AI is also revolutionizing the entertainment and media industries. Streaming services like Netflix and Spotify use AI algorithms to provide personalized content recommendations based on user preferences and viewing habits. In gaming, AI is making virtual characters more lifelike and responsive, while in content creation, AI tools are helping generate scripts, music, and even realistic deepfake videos. Additionally, AI is enhancing special effects in movies and enabling the creation of virtual actors.
AI's Impact on Society
While AI's influence on industries is profound, its societal impact is even more significant. AI is changing how we live, work, and interact with the world around us.
1. Automation and the Future of Work
AI-driven automation is reshaping the workforce, automating repetitive tasks and freeing up human workers to focus on higher-level tasks that require creativity, critical thinking, and emotional intelligence. However, this also raises concerns about job displacement, especially in industries like manufacturing and customer service. As AI continues to advance, reskilling and upskilling will be crucial to ensure that workers can adapt to new roles created by AI-powered technologies.
2. Ethics and Privacy
With the growing power of AI comes the need for careful consideration of its ethical implications. Issues such as data privacy, algorithmic bias, and transparency in AI decision-making are critical concerns. AI systems can make decisions based on biased datasets, leading to unfair outcomes in areas like hiring, law enforcement, and lending. Ensuring that AI is developed and deployed responsibly will be key to minimizing these risks and ensuring that AI benefits society as a whole.
3. Healthcare Accessibility
AI has the potential to bridge healthcare gaps, particularly in underserved areas. By providing remote diagnostics, AI-powered tools can bring medical expertise to regions that lack healthcare infrastructure. Moreover, AI's ability to analyze vast amounts of data can help identify health trends and guide public health interventions, improving global health outcomes.
4. Education and Learning
AI is transforming education by enabling personalized learning experiences. Intelligent tutoring systems can adapt to individual students' needs, helping them learn at their own pace. AI-powered platforms can assess student performance in real-time, offering insights and guidance to teachers. Additionally, AI can help address accessibility challenges by providing tools like speech recognition and translation for students with disabilities or language barriers.
